We saw a great concert in the Congress Theatre which has...

We saw a great concert in the Congress Theatre which has many good shows throughout the year. There are several other good theatres and in the summer a top ranking Tennis Tournament.The coastal walks are also excellent with Beachy Head nearby for amazing views. Plenty of Hotels of different sizes and costs--lots of good eateries. Good transport links--frequent buses and good train service to Gatwick Airport and London stations of London Bridge and Victoria.

We stayed at the Cavendish Hotel on the sea front, not far...

We stayed at the Cavendish Hotel on the sea front, not far from the pier which had a very nice tea room. The town centre was 10 minutes walk away with a variety of shops in the Beacon Centre as well on the parade. The railway station was close to the town and there were buses the other end which could take you to Hastings and Brighton. At the time of our visit, there was an area closed off for work which made it a bit awkward to get through, but overall plenty of cheap shops, charity shops, clothes shops and cafes.
